PALO ALTO, CA — A Palo Alto resident was confronted by a would-be burglar with a knife on Wednesday night, according to the Palo Alto Police Department.

The resident, who lives on the 4000 block of Park Boulevard, saw a man in his backyard around 6:19 p.m., peering into a window.

The resident, a man in his 40s, confronted the prowler through his window. The suspect then brandished a small kitchen knife before fleeing northbound on Park Avenue, according to police.

The victim then called police.

The suspect is described as a white male of unknown age, about 5-foot-5 with stocky build. He was wearing all-black, and a white a face covering with an image of “monster teeth.”
